The nature of Romanticism may be approached from the primary importance of the free expression of the feelings of the artist. The importance the Romantics placed on emotion is summed up in the remark of the German painter Caspar David Friedrich, "the artist's feeling is his law". The Romantic period arose in part when a society has grown tired of trends in intellectual thought, rationalization, industrialization, and the veneration of science. People longed for the escape of emotionally charged images and fantastical fiction in the visual arts and in literature.
